sm-rollei-DR5.jpgThe Rollei dr5 is a 25mm (almost flat) 5 MP digital camera. This product will have a 4.8x optical zoom and 3.6x digital zoom. Users can either use the built-in optical zoom or the 1.8" LCD monitor. The macro mode allows photographers to take pictures as close as 1cm to 13cm away. Another strong feature of the camera is the .8 second lag from power-on to shooting. The shutter lag is no more than .10 second. The camera also allows continuous shooting, and has a timer you can set for either 2 or 10 seconds. The unit has 256-zone metering plus center-weighted average and spot metering. There is an automatic white balance, plus settings for sunlight, cloudy, tungsten and fluorescent. The camera also has automatic red-eye reduction and fill-flash modes. There is also a QuickTime video setting (with sound). The camera will operate on two AA batteries or a lithium-ion block. This unit will be available in March for 299 Euro.
